With characteristic empathy, the two-time Palme d’Or-winning Dardenne brothers follow the experiences of several such girls housed in a residential shelter in Liege, Belgium. Jessica is heavily pregnant and seeks to contact the woman who gave her up to the care system as a baby. Julie considers giving up her daughter for adoption, yet her own troubled mother wishes to raise the child to atone for her past mistakes. Perla, mother to baby Noe, naively hopes her delinquent boyfriend will settle down and start a family. And Ariane, who has the privilege of a loving partner, is at odds with her physically and emotionally abusive mother. Notes by David O’Mahony.
